#83. Helena, MT
The capital of Montana and a city with four distinct seasons,Helena is between Glacier and Yellowstone national parks and features outdoor recreation like boating, fishing, hiking, hunting and mountain biking. More than 30 percent of the local workforce is involved in government positions, and students have academic choices such as Carroll College and Helena College University of Montana. Another livability convenience is Helena Regional Airport.
